Ingredients
For the Meatballs:
1 lb ground chicken
1 small onion, finely chopped
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tbsp grated ginger
1 tsp ground cumin
1 tsp ground coriander
1/2 tsp turmeric
1/2 tsp paprika
1/2 tsp salt
1/4 tsp black pepper
1/4 tsp cayenne pepper (optional)
1/4 cup breadcrumbs
1 large egg
2 tbsp vegetable oil
For the Coconut Curry Sauce:
1 tbsp vegetable oil
1 small onion, finely chopped
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tbsp grated ginger
1 tsp ground cumin
1 tsp ground coriander
1/2 tsp turmeric
1/2 tsp paprika
1/2 tsp salt
1/4 tsp black pepper
1/4 tsp cayenne pepper (optional)
1 can (14 oz) coconut milk
1 cup chicken broth
1 tbsp cornstarch mixed with 1 tbsp water
Fresh cilantro for garnish
Lime wedges for serving
Instructions
-
Make the Meatballs:
-
In a large bowl, combine ground chicken, onion, garlic, ginger, cumin, coriander, turmeric, paprika, salt, pepper, cayenne, breadcrumbs, and egg. Mix well and form into 1-inch meatballs.
-
-
Cook the Meatballs:
-
Heat vegetable o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add the meatballs and cook for 5–7 minutes, turning occasionally, until golden brown on all sides. Remove and set aside.
-
-
Prepare the Curry Sauce:
-
In the same skillet, add oil and sauté onion, garlic, and ginger for 2–3 minutes. Add cumin, coriander, turmeric, paprika, salt, black pepper, and cayenne. Cook for another minute until fragrant.
-
-
Simmer the Sauce:
-
Pour in coconut milk and chicken broth, stirring to combine. Bring to a simmer, then add the cornstarch mixture to thicken the sauce. Stir and cook for 5 minutes.
-
-
Cook the Meatballs in the Sauce:
-
Return the meatballs to the skillet and simmer for 10–15 minutes, until the meatballs are cooked through and the sauce has thickened.
-
-
Serve:
-
Garnish with fresh cilantro and serve with lime wedges.

Notes
Different Protein: Swap ground chicken for turkey, beef, or firm tofu for a variation.
Add Vegetables: Add spinach, bell peppers, or peas to the sauce for extra nutrition.
Spicier: Adjust the cayenne pepper or add fresh chili peppers for a spicier version.
Make Ahead: Prepare the meatballs and curry sauce in advance and store separately. Reheat and combine when ready to serve.
